Both parties heralded the first year of the partnership as a ‘complete success’ with trade sales through youtravel.com making up a significant of proportion of easyCruise's UK sales.
Bookings from the UK account for around 50% of the line's overall sales.
easyCruise sales and marketing director, Paul Ellerby, said: ‘I’m delighted to have renewed the youtravel.com deal. Last year worked really well for both of us and I am sure that thanks to new itineraries, including a new seven-night cruise from Bodrum, the relationship will continue to go from strength to strength.’
Liz Garfield, national sales manager for youtravel.com, added: ‘We’ve worked closely with the easyCruise team to ensure that our agent partners have got access to great value prices. Our prices are on a half-board basis and include housekeeping services.’
The two companies are planning another joint fam trip for spring 2009, to highlight
easyCruise Life’s new cruise itineraries out of Athens and Bodrum.
The easyCruise itineraries can be booked via the ‘cruise’ tab on the youtravel.com homepage.
